Can I take methylcobalamin at night?

There is no specific time of day recommended when you should take vitamin B-12 supplements, as there is no clinical evidence demonstrating a significant difference between taking vitamin B-12 in the morning or at night.

Can I take 5000 mcg B12 is it too much?

In fact, 5000 mcg of Vitamin B12 supplementation is a safe dosing amount. Although, you do not need to consume that much. With the RDA at only 2.4 mcg for healthy adults, taking 5000 mcg just creates expensive urine. You can safely dose at lower levels and still reach the RDA. What is the difference between 2.4 mcg and 1000 mcg? 2.4mcg is only approximately 1/250th of 1000mcg.

What is methylcobalamin B12 used for?

Vitamin B12 deficiency can be treated with methylcobalamin. Vitamin B12 is essential for the brain, nerves, as well as for the production red blood cells. Pernicious anemia, diabetes, or other conditions may be treated with methylcobalamin.

What is the difference between Hydroxy B12 and methyl B12?

These two forms of B12 have shown very similar methods of action, absorption efficiency and effectiveness. The difference here is that Hydroxycobalamin lasts longer in your body. It is not put into the more bioactive form of Methyl right away so your body doesn't use it all up at once.
